Advanced Blood Sugar Management

Presented by FDN

4 CEs


The Advanced Blood Sugar Management course is an online, self-paced training designed to provide practitioners and health professionals with a deep understanding of blood sugar regulation and its clinical implications. The program explores the physiology, anatomy, and biochemistry of blood sugar regulation, the far-reaching impacts of insulin resistance, and its influence on multiple organ systems and symptom presentation.

Participants learn to recognise patterns of blood sugar dysregulation, assess dysfunction through lab testing, and compare conventional versus optimal ranges for key markers. Practical strategies for dietary, lifestyle, and herbal interventions are included, alongside case studies and additional resources to support integration into clinical practice.

This comprehensive course equips students with the tools needed to address root causes of blood sugar dysfunction and apply evidence-informed approaches to improve client outcomes.

By the end of the course, participants will be able to:
• Explain the anatomy, physiology, and biochemistry of blood sugar regulation.
• Identify signs, symptoms, and root causes of blood sugar imbalance.
• Apply nutritional, lifestyle, and herbal strategies to support healthy blood sugar balance.
• Interpret lab results, recognise patterns of dysfunction, and compare conventional versus optimal ranges.
• Integrate practical case study learnings into client protocols.
